Output 0663e8f4a3ced02e97e3c60a2ce0c4bccfabc90a18bf0d4f5bff760b6fc5f5c8:0

value
3418856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d272a79933d5e1781fe26b6626b37d3a0de9568 OP_EQUAL
address
3EZN7tRpTdFFxTpF2TWUA4QZSGmjpHSMoa
transaction
0663e8f4a3ced02e97e3c60a2ce0c4bccfabc90a18bf0d4f5bff760b6fc5f5c8
spent
true